#47665b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#47665b is composed of 27.8% red, 40%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.8%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 158.7 degrees, a saturation of 17.9% and a lightness of 33.9%. #47665b color hex could be obtained by blending #8eccb6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#47665b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070908 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#47665b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545957 is the less saturated color, while #04a96e is the most saturated one.
